Copper-Mediated C-N Coupling of Arylsilanes with Nitrogen Nucleophiles
Johannes Morstein1, Eric D Kalkman1, Christian Bold
1Department of Chemistry, University of California , Berkeley, California 94720, United States.
Abstract:
A method for the oxidative coupling of arylsilanes with nitrogen nucleophiles is reported. This method occurs with a broad range of heptamethyltrisiloxylarenes and nitrogen nucleophiles, proceeds with the arylsilane as limiting reagent, and does not require a fluoride activator with electron-poor arylsilanes. The combination of this method with C-H silylation generates arylamines from unactivated arenes with site selectivity controlled by steric effects. This combination of steps gives direct access to many compounds that cannot be accessed via alternative C-H functionalization methods, including direct C-H amination or the combination of C-H borylation and amination.
